The leather ankle boots Bronx Mac-ey represent the perfect blend of elegance and comfort for the modern woman. Designed by the renowned brand Bronx, these boots stand out with their refined style that suits all occasions.

Made from high-quality leather, these boots offer exceptional durability while providing a pleasant wearing experience. The leather's texture adds a sophisticated touch, making each pair a must-have fashion choice.

Their design is carefully crafted to provide good foot support, with a shape that follows the natural curves of the ankle. This not only ensures optimal comfort but also enhances your legs.

Here are some key features of the Bronx Mac-ey ankle boots:

  • Material: Premium leather for increased longevity and a timeless style.
  • Comfort: Padded insole that ensures pleasant cushioning while walking.
  • Style: Chic and timeless design that pairs well with a variety of outfits, from casual looks to more formal attire.
  • Easy maintenance: Leather boots are easy to clean and maintain, allowing you to keep them in perfect condition all year round.
